Bats, belonging to the order Chiroptera, are fascinating mammals known for their unique ability to fly, making them the only mammals capable of true sustained flight. With over 1,400 species, they are the second largest order of mammals. Bats play crucial ecological roles, such as pollinating plants, dispersing seeds, and controlling insect populations. They are found in nearly every part of the world, thriving in a diverse range of habitats. Despite common misconceptions, bats are generally harmless to humans and are vital to maintaining balanced ecosystems.
